Conditions

GNE Myopathy, also known as Hereditary Inclusion Body Myopathy (HIBM), Distal Myopathy with Rimmed Vacuoles (DMRV), Nonaka's disease, or quadriceps sparing myopathy (QSM) MedDRA version: 20.0 Level: LLT Classification code 10075048 Term: Hereditary inclusion body myopathy System Organ Class: 100000004850

Inclusion criteria

Inclusion criteria: 1) Male or female, aged 18 - 50 years, inclusive 2) Willing and able to provide written, signed informed consent after the nature of the study has been explained, and before any research-related procedures are conducted 3) Have a documented diagnosis of GNEM, HIBM, DMRV, or Nonaka disease due to previously demonstrated mutations in the gene encoding the GNE/MNK enzyme (genotyping will not be conducted in this study) 4) Able to provide reproducible force in elbow flexors (i.e. two dynamometry force values with no more than 15% variability in the dominant arm) at Screening 5) Able to walk a minimum of 200 meters during the 6MWT at Screening without the use of assistive devices, including a cane, crutch(es), walker, wheelchair or scooter (AFOs are permitted) 6) Willing and able to comply with all study procedures 7) Participants of child-bearing potential or with partners of childbearing potential who have not undergone a bilateral salpingooophorectomy and are sexually active must consent to use an effective method of contraception as determined by the site investigator (i.e. oral hormonal contraceptives, patch hormonal contraceptives, vaginal ring, intrauterine device, physical double-barrier methods, surgical hysterectomy, vasectomy, tubal ligation, or true abstinence) from the period following the signing of the informed consent through 3 months after last dose of study drug 8) Females of childbearing potential must have a negative pregnancy test at Screening and be willing to have additional pregnancy tests during the study. Females considered not of childbearing potential include those who have been in menopause for at least two years, have had tubal ligation at least one year prior to Screening, or who have had a total hysterectomy or bilateral salpingooophorectomy Are the trial subjects under 18? no Number of subjects for this age range: F.1.2 Adults (18-64 years) yes F.1.2.1 Number of subjects for this age range 89 F.1.3 Elderly (>=65 years) no F.1.3.1 Number of subjects for this age range

Exclusion criteria

Exclusion criteria: 1) Ingestion of N-acetyl-D-mannosamine (ManNAc), SA, or related metabolites; intravenous immunoglobulin (IVIG); or anything that can be metabolized to produce SA in the body within 60 days prior to the Screening Visit 2) History of more than 30 days treatment with SA-ER and/or SA-IR in prior clinical trials in the past year 3) Has had any hypersensitivity to SA or its excipients that, in the judgment of the investigator, places the subject at increased risk for adverse effects 4) Has serum transaminase (i.e. aspartate aminotransferase [AST] or gamma-glutamyl transpeptidase [GGT]) levels greater than 3X the upper limit of normal (ULN) for age/gender, or serum creatinine of greater than 2X ULN at Screening 5) Pregnant or breastfeeding at Screening or planning to become pregnant (self or partner) at any time during the study 6) Use of any investigational product or investigational medical device within 30 days prior to Screening, or anticipated requirement for any investigational agent prior to completion of all scheduled study assessments 7) Has a condition of such severity and acuity, in the opinion of the investigator, that it warrants immediate surgical intervention or other treatment or may not allow safe participation in the study 8) Has a concurrent disease, active suicidal ideation, or other condition that, in the view of the investigator, places the subject at high risk of poor treatment compliance or of not completing the study, or would interfere with study participation or would affect safety

Design outcomes

Primary

MeasureTime frame
Main Objective: Evaluate the effect of 6 g/day SA-ER treatment of subjects with GNEM on upper extremity muscle strength (UEC score) as measured by dynamometry;Secondary Objective: Key Secondary Objectives: Evaluate the effect of 6 g/day of SA-ER treatment of subjects with GNEM on: ¿ Lower extremity composite muscle strength score (LEC score) as measured by dynamometry ¿ Muscle strength in the knee extensors as measured by dynamometry ¿ Physical functioning as measured using the GNEM-FAS mobility domain score Other Secondary Objectives: Evaluate the effect of 6 g/day of SA-ER treatment of subjects with GNEM on: ¿ Physical functioning as measured using the GNEM-FAS upper extremity domain score ¿ Lower extremity function as measured by a timed sit-to-stand test ¿ Upper extremity function as measured by a timed weighted arm lift test ¿ Lower extremity function as measured by distance walked in the 6MWT ;Primary end point(s): The primary clinical efficacy analysis will be the change from baseline in UEC score for the SA-ER group compared with placebo based on bilateral strength recorded in the following muscle groups using a dynamometer: gross grip, shoulder abductors, elbow flexors, and elbow extensors. The UEC is derived from the sum of the muscle groups. Each muscle group value will represent the average of the right and left total values (measured in kg). The comparison of the two treatment groups will be based on the change from baseline in mean UEC score between SA-ER and placebo using GEE repeated measures analysis with baseline, gender, and geographic region as covariates. ;Timepoint(s) of evaluation of this end point: Baseline, Week 8, 16, 24, 32, 40, 48

Secondary

MeasureTime frame
Secondary end point(s): Key Secondary Endpoints: the key secondary clinical efficacy analyses will assess the change from baseline for the SA-ER group compared with the placebo group using GEE for the following variables: ¿ LEC score based on a sum of the mean bilateral strength recorded in the following muscle groups: knee flexors, hip flexors, hip extensors, hip abductors and hip adductors ¿ Muscle strength in the knee extensors: bilateral total force (measured in kg) ¿ GNEM-FAS mobility domain score Other Secondary Endpoints: the analysis of other secondary endpoints will assess the change from baseline for the SA-ER group compared to the placebo group using GEE for the following variables: ¿ GNEM-FAS upper extremity domain score ¿ Sit-to-stand score calculated as the number of times a subject can rise from a sitting to a standing position in a 30-second period ¿ Weighted arm lift score calculated as the number of times a subject can raise a 1 kg weight overhead in a 30-second period ¿ Walking ability as measured by the 6MWT, which will be reported as distance in meters and percent predicted based on normative data for age and gender. ;Timepoint(s) of evaluation of this end point: Baseline, Week 8, 16, 24, 32, 40, 48
